Mantel and Table Clocks

Pendulette cage clock with photophore

    Pendulette cage clock with photophore

    Circa 1770

    James Cox

    Gold, silver, steel, brass, glass, bronze, agate, garnet; mechanical work, casting, gilding, setting of gemstones, stone cutting

    Height: 11.4 cm

    On the dial: "Jas. Cox London"

    further...

    Mechanical table clock with photophore on top. The vertical clock case features an openwork gilt octagonal frame with a flared base and an engraved plinth. Cast ornamental elements of the frame consist of a combination of rocaille motifs, bouquets, and flower heads. The openwork frame panels are set with plaques of red agate with white veining. The front features white enamel dial with Roman numerals for the hours, minute markers, and Arabic numerals for five-minute intervals.

    The dial and the balance wheel window are covered with hinged lid with two convex crystals. The crystals are framed by chains of clear red stones. Votive light shaped like a conical glass cup with a rounded base is mounted atop the case
